great show, both NY and Boston have been amazing so far

correct tracklist

MFFF (unplugged)
Elephant
The rat within the grain
Amie > Sex change
Older chests
The Box
The Greatest Bastard
Woman like a man
It Takes a lot to know a man
The Professor
Delicate
Volcano
9 crimes
I Remember
---
I don´t wanna change you
Cannonball
The blower´s daughter
Long Way>Cold Water>Long Way
